Set in one of Whitstable's most desirable locations, a hundred yards from the seafront, this 1930's three-bedroom house boasts a 120ft south-facing rear garden, and incorporates a detached garage and off-street parking. This pretty home enjoys rooms of large proportions and plenty of original features, although there is bags of potential to extend and enhance if desired (subject to necessary consents). Internally, the ground floor offers a spacious living room to the front, separate dining room and galley kitchen at the rear. Through the kitchen we have a garden study/bedroom four along with an open plan W.C/shower room. Onto the first floor, we find three well-proportioned bedrooms and the family bathroom. The loft space is now an easy access area utilising a space saving staircase. Externally, we have a secluded front garden along with the aforementioned rear garden. The off-street parking and garage/workshop are accessed via Collingwood Road, which runs adjacent to the golf course, with many neighbouring properties having developed their garages into much grander buildings, suggesting a precedent.
